Local vrs. Mega Church
In your opinion, When do you consider a church to be too "large"?
As a pastor, I would have a problem having a congregation that is so large that I can't know my sheep. I know that mega churches have multiple pastors in many different functions, but How can that be a good thing? I think a congregation of a couple hundred is ok but when the numbers get too high it becomes kinda impersonal and more like a machine. This is only my opinion, I would love to hear some input, especially from Pastors and Ministers, but Would love to hear the "voice of the pew" speak on this one too, after all, Its you guys that We are here to serve! |

Re: Local vrs. Mega Church
As a church grows you must restructure and add more pastors so that some pastor knows each saints name.
Do you think Peter knew the name of each of he 3,000 on the day of Pentecost? I don't expect the senior pastor of a large church to know my name but I do want opportunities to get involved in smaller groups, classes, etc where some pastor or pastors do. |
